The Ministry of Health (Kemenkes) recorded 147 districts/cities with a weekly confirmed positive Covid-19 case count above the national average, currently recorded at 2.2 per 100,000 population/week, data as of Saturday, December 17, 2022.
The top five districts/cities with confirmed positive cases exceeding 25.06 per 100,000 population/week are Central Jakarta, South Jakarta, West Jakarta, East Jakarta, and Cimahi City, with respective values of 31.85 per 100,000 population/week, 29.84 per 100,000 population/week, 25.69 per 100,000 population/week, 25.53 per 100,000 population/week, and 25.06 per 100,000 population/week.
A recapitulation of national Covid data from the Ministry of Health shows that confirmed positive cases in most districts/cities outside Java have decreased. A higher than previous daily confirmed positive case count was recorded in 44 districts/cities, while 103 districts/cities recorded lower confirmed positive cases.
Areas outside Java with the highest confirmed positive case rates include Belitung, Balangan, and Teluk Bintuni, with confirmed positive cases of 24.47 per 100,000 population/week, 16.35 per 100,000 population/week, and 14.46 per 100,000 population/week, respectively.
